Numismatics

ID number:  BIRBI-R1424
Object type:  Coin
Institution:  The Barber Institute of Fine Arts
Named collection:  G. Haines Collection
Collector:  Haines, Geoffrey
Maker:  Macrinus; Rome
Denomination:  Antoninianus
Place made:  Rome
Culture:  Roman
Date made:  217-218
Metal:  Silver
Diameter (cm):  2.20
Weight (g):  5.10
Axis (degrees):  180.00
Provenance:  Haines 1091. In Paris, 1929.
BIRBI-R1424.jpg

Description:  Obverse: Head of Macrinus, wearing radiate crown, curiassed, and short-bearded, facing r. Reverse: Felicitas, draped and standing facing l., holding short caduceus in r. and sceptre in l.

Inscriptions:  Obverse: IMP C III OΓLI SEV MΛCNIIIVS AVG (Imperator Caear, Marcus Opellius Severus Macrinus Augustus). Reverse: FELICITAS T[MPOHVM (Good Fortune of the Age).

Bibliography:  RIC IV 63E
